Patrick joined the Camp Ozark Permanent Staff in 2009. He now serves as the Director of Ministry Resources and Camper Programming for Torn Family Camps. Patrick also serves as a Senior Operating Director at Camp Ozark.
Patrick grew up in Illinois and first connected with Camp Ozark in the fall of 2002 as a college freshman. While spending each of his college summers at Ozark, Patrick triple-majored as an undergraduate at Vanderbilt University. He then studied theology in graduate school for five years, earning masters degrees at Duke University and Harvard University along the way. Patrick is honored to now serve as the theologian-in-residence for Torn Family Camps. In the midst of all this, Patrick met his wife, Katie, at Camp Ozark during the summer of 2007. They welcomed their son, Bhrett, in 2012. Out and about in their Houston community, Patrick can be found coaching Bhrett’s soccer teams, teaching adult classes at Houston’s First Baptist Church, serving on the SBMSA Soccer Board, eating out at his and Katie’s favorite restaurants, and frequenting the movie theater for big-budget action flicks.
